| 2 | Author: | Romero, José, active 1822-1826. | Add to Favorites | | Title: | Letter of Jose Romero,
1824 ead | | | Date(s): | 1824 | | | Abstract: | Jose Romero was a Lieutenant Colonel, Sonora, Mexico; leader of 1823-1826 expeditions to
establish an inland route between Sonora, Mex. and California. Collection contains a letter
(photocopy) to Mariana de Urrea, Commandante General de Sonora, from Romero in San Gabriel, Calif.,
recounting his experiences in attempting unsuccessfully to return to Sonora in the winter of 1823-1824
through the Palm Springs area, and describing the mail route between Tucson and San Gabriel which was
conducted by Jose Cocomaricopa, the bearer of this letter, via the Colorado River route. | | | Repository: | University of Arizona Libraries, Special Collections | | | Subjects: | Postal service -- Southwest, New -- History -- Sources. | | | Similar Items: | Find Similar Guides |

11 | Author: | United States. Army. Ambulance Service. | Add to Favorites | | Title: | Official Report of the Chief of the United States Army Ambulance Service with the French Army, to the Surgeon General of the Army
1919 ead | | | Date(s): | 1919 | | | Abstract: | The United States Army Ambulance Service, also known as the USAAS, was created by presidential order May 18, 1917, for the duration of
the "existing emergency." This original typescript relates the history of the Ambulance Service with the French Army on the
Western Front, during WWI. A signed introduction by Col. Percy L. Jones, Paris, April 15, 1919, states that the report is in compliance
with instructions given by the Surgeon General, Nov. 27, 1918. | | | Repository: | University of Arizona Libraries, Special Collections | | | Subjects: | Ambulance service -- France -- History -- 20th century. | Ambulances -- History -- 20th century. | Argonne, Battle of the, France, 1918. | World War, 1914-1918 -- Medical care -- France. | | | Similar Items: | Find Similar Guides |
